The Ebace event, short for the European Business Aviation Convention & Exhibition, has always been a prominent gathering of industry professionals, enthusiasts, and media representatives from around the world. In 2012, it captured even more attention as the aviation industry was going through significant changes.
The Mediatzu Media Reports, known for their comprehensive coverage and insightful analysis, delved into the media landscape during the 2012 Ebace event. Their findings provide a unique perspective on the state of business aviation and the media's response to it back then.

Key Analysis and Findings
One noteworthy finding from the Mediatzu Media Reports is the considerable media attention on emerging markets, particularly China and India. The analysis reveals that the growing economies in these regions sparked great interest in the aviation industry, leading to an increased focus on potential business opportunities.
Furthermore, the reports highlight the growing influence of digital media platforms. Social media, blogs, and online news outlets played a significant role in disseminating information and generating discussions about the event. This shift to digital platforms allowed for real-time updates, greater engagement, and generated substantial online conversations among industry professionals and aviation enthusiasts alike.
The 2012 Ebace Media Report also brings attention to the industry's growing commitment towards sustainability. The reports indicate a surge in media coverage regarding green aviation practices, alternative fuels, and the pursuit of more eco-friendly business aviation solutions. This heightened focus on sustainability illustrates the growing awareness and responsibility within the industry.
